Local anesthetic is used to numb the treated area during your root canal procedure. This can take up to two hours to wear off, so we ask that you avoid hot liquids and chewing food until the area is no longer numb. Chewing while your mouth is numb can cause soft tissue injury.
WebAug 24, 2024 · When to seek help. Root canal pain should decrease over time. If you still experience pain or swelling, you should see your dentist. WebPain after a root canal is typically mild and only lasts a few days; it is a normal and manageable after-effect. Many people will experience no pain at all – and studies show that only 3 to 6 percent of people treated with a root canal experience what they classify as “severe pain” in the days following the procedure. 6.
